Name __________________________________________________________________________________ Enzyme Lab: Demonstration Background Information First, you need a little background about gelatin… and it may be more than you ever wanted to know. Do you know what Jell-O is really made from? Are you ready? That sweet colorful treat is actually made out of hides, bones, and inedible connecting tissue from animals butchered for meat. No? Yup! All gelatin is made out of discarded animal parts — the tough parts: bone and skin. Moreover, all these tough parts are made of proteins. In fact, the extracted gelatin is a protein. As with some other tropical fruits, the pineapple fruit contains an enzyme that breaks down, or digests, protein. Enzymes are protein molecules that speed up chemical reactions in living organisms. Enzymes are very specific in their action. Some enzymes cause molecules to separate while others may join molecules together. The protease (protein-digesting) enzyme in pineapple is called bromelain, which is extracted and sold in such products as Schilling's Meat Tenderizer.
